The In Place Upgrade for Cyrus IMAP 3.2 → 3.4 says at
https://www.cyrusimap.org/3.4/imap/download/upgrade.html :
• stop all processes,
• install new binaries,
• start the master process with the new binaries first,
• then reconstruct databases and cache: reconstruct -V max &&
ctl_conversationsdb -b -r && quota -f && dav_reconstruct -a

I followed this procedure, and then some VEVENTS/VTODOs, which I have
deleted in the past but were still on my disk, reappeared as undeleted.
As far as I remember, during the upgrade 3.0 → 3.2 one year ago exactly
the same phenomenon happened.

Any advices how to avoid this (deleted iCalendar object re-appear after
upgrade) in the future will be highly appreciated.
